For dissolution testing of ordinary instant-release formulations making use of either the USP apparatus I or II, the test setup is generally speaking significantly less advanced and of shorter duration when compared with the test set up for controlled release dosage kinds. According to the European Pharmacopoeia (Ph.Eur.), just one ideal dissolution medium ought to be used for regular release solid-dosage types. In distinction, a two-phase test is required for delayed release dosage varieties. An acid stage of two hours, by which the formulation ought to release under ten%, is accompanied by a buffer stage at pH six.

The validation with the dissolution process should involve specificity testing to ensure that there is no interference with other parts (e.g., excipients or dissolution media elements). Also, accuracy along with linearity in excess of the calibration range need to be examined and should go over the lowest expected focus to more than the best focus all through release testing. Precision and Restoration may be founded by preparing samples that contains the drug and any other constituents present while in the dosage kind (such as, excipients, coating components, and capsule shell) ranging in focus from underneath the lowest anticipated concentration to earlier mentioned the best focus in the course of release. ICH endorses at least 9 determinations over a minimum of three concentrations — by way of example, 3 concentrations, three replicates Every.

When establishing a dissolution procedure that includes an HPLC assay, the compatibility with the dissolution media With all the cell stage should be regarded as, particularly if big injector volumes (in excess of a hundred μL) are wanted. One injections of each vessel time stage with benchmarks all over the operate represent a normal operate style. Whatever the manner of assay used, even so, the course of action has to be validated.
